Texas State (stud): Tactical Approach and Current Form

Texas State (stud) enters this match with a mixed bag of results in their recent form, having won 3 of their last 5 games. A standout feature of their play has been their exceptional defense, ranking in the top 20 for defensive efficiency in the NCAA. The team thrives on slowing the pace of the game, often limiting their opponents to under 65 points per contest. Their defensive strategy is built around pressuring ball handlers, denying space in the paint, and controlling the defensive glass—Texas State is averaging 36.2 rebounds per game, with an impressive 8.3 offensive rebounds, a key aspect of their second-chance points.

Offensively, Texas State prefers a methodical half-court offense. They often look to set up their offense through the pick-and-roll, with their point guard facilitating opportunities for the shooters on the wing and their big men rolling to the basket. Texas State's three-point shooting percentage hovers around 33%, with their success largely dependent on the performance of their perimeter shooters. However, they need to improve their ball movement, as their assist-to-turnover ratio stands at 1.3, which could hurt them against more dynamic teams.

Key players to watch include their star forward, who has been a consistent double-double threat, averaging 15 points and 10 rebounds over their last five games. Their point guard, a steady floor general, is pivotal in managing the tempo and distributing the ball efficiently. However, Texas State will be without their starting shooting guard due to an ankle injury, which leaves a gap in their perimeter shooting and floor spacing.

Marshall (stud): Tactical Approach and Current Form

Marshall (stud), on the other hand, has enjoyed a more dynamic run, winning 4 out of their last 5 games. Known for their high-octane offense, Marshall ranks in the top 10 for points per game in the NCAA, averaging over 80 points a contest. Their offensive system is centered around fast breaks, pushing the ball up the floor with speed and precision. Marshall is lethal in transition, led by a fleet-footed point guard who excels in pushing the tempo and creating easy fast-break opportunities for their wings.

The Thundering Herd also has a potent half-court offense, relying on a balanced attack. Their center has been dominant in the paint, providing both scoring and rim protection, while their wings are capable of stretching the floor with their three-point shooting. Marshall’s shooting efficiency, especially from beyond the arc, stands at 36.7%, with their shooting guard and small forward being the primary threats from deep. However, their defense can be porous at times, as they allow an average of 74 points per game, ranking in the bottom half of the league for defensive efficiency.

Marshall’s recent form has been fueled by the stellar play of their star point guard, who is averaging 7 assists per game over their last five games, and their center, who has been a rebounding machine. However, Marshall will need to tighten up their defense to stand a chance against Texas State’s physical style and slow pace. With their defensive ranking being a concern, Marshall will need to ensure they can keep Texas State from getting easy second-chance points and scoring efficiently in the half-court.

Head-to-Head: History and Psychology

In recent meetings between these two teams, Marshall has had the upper hand, winning 3 of the last 5 encounters. However, the games have been closely contested, with the average margin of victory being less than 5 points. The contrast in playing styles has been a recurring theme: Texas State’s grind-it-out defense has often clashed with Marshall’s fast-paced offense. One of the defining moments from their last meeting was when Marshall’s transition game overwhelmed Texas State, leading to a 10-point victory despite a strong defensive effort from Texas State.

Looking at the psychological aspect, Texas State will enter this game with a chip on their shoulder, feeling the need to assert their defensive dominance and prove that their deliberate style can stifle Marshall’s high-speed offense. On the other hand, Marshall will likely approach the match with confidence, knowing their offensive prowess can potentially break down Texas State’s defense if they can find rhythm early in the game.

Key Battles and Critical Zones

The most pivotal battle will undoubtedly take place in the paint. Texas State’s frontcourt is known for being physical and dominating the boards, while Marshall’s center is a force to be reckoned with on both ends of the floor. If Marshall’s center can hold his ground and win the battle for rebounds, it will allow their team to push the ball in transition and control the tempo. Conversely, if Texas State can neutralize Marshall’s center and limit second-chance opportunities, they will force Marshall into a half-court game, where they excel.

Another crucial battle will be between the point guards. Texas State’s point guard is tasked with controlling the tempo and limiting Marshall’s fast-break opportunities. If they can limit turnovers and set up the offense efficiently, they’ll give Texas State a real shot at slowing the game down. However, if Marshall’s point guard can push the pace and create fast-break opportunities, it will be a major factor in breaking down Texas State’s defensive structure.

Finally, the three-point shooting duel will be another key factor. Texas State’s ability to knock down perimeter shots, especially in the absence of their injured shooting guard, will be a defining element. Marshall’s wings, on the other hand, have shown they can light it up from beyond the arc, and if they find their range early, it could force Texas State to adjust defensively.
